Thank you for the quick response .It wil be difficult to get an answer what this Junker did in the sky above Holland feb 1937 .
But older people from the village told me that the pilot was lost and that he was thinking that he was flying over the river Rhein but instead he was flying over the river Maas and he was short of petrol so they have to make an emergency landing at the hamlet of Haler .

This aircraft was a Junkers W.34 hi Werk-Nummer 344 and accepted by the Luftwaffe in August 1935.
